Certification Provides Benefits


Four levels of Casting Instructor Certification Program

  1. Casting Instructor
  2. Master Casting Instructor
  3. Two Hand Casting Instructor 
  4. Master Two Hand Casting Instructor

Why Certify?

Obtaining an instructor certification with FFI takes you to a new level of professionalism and instills self-confidence in your teaching abilities. Quality instruction, particularly on slow fishing days, will increase guest return rates, as guests return for both fishing and further instruction.

Benefits of a Certified Casting Instructor include:

  • Become a more effective casting instructor, by being exposed to the state-of-the-art in casting and casting instruction.
  • Become part of a network of the best casting instructors in the world. Men and women who are eager to share their knowledge of casting instruction and would like to learn from you too. 
  • Listed on Fly Fishers International's website with a link to your email.
  • Receive FFI's casting journal, The Loop. Find teaching tips for Certified Casting Instructors inside.
  • Receive a certificate of completion, suitable for framing.

Financial Commitment

FFI's Casting Instructor Certification Program comes with a financial commitment which includes an examination fee, a pass fee, and an annual renewal fee.   The fees collected support the examiner's expenses as well as the on-going operations of the program.

Examinations fees are $350 for a CI exam or $450 for an MCI, THCI, or THMCI exam.  Please read the Casting Exam Refund Policy before you sign up for an exam.

Pass fee - prorated to match your membership expiration; typical $50 which covers up to 1 year of dues.  

1 Year - $45 (renewal rates once you become a Certified Casting Instructor)

Must be a current FFI member to maintain certification status.
